Apple's redesigned 13-inch MacBook is essentially a shrunken version of the more expensive 15-inch Pro line. With its new aluminum body, new trackpad, and Nvidia graphics, it's an even more attractive choice for mainstream laptop buyers than was the plastic model it replaces.

Apple CEO Steve Jobs shows off the updated version of the popular MacBook laptop. New features include Nvidia graphics, a glass multitouch trackpad, a thinner casing crafted from a single block of aluminum, solid state drives, some price reductions, and more.
